The Weatherhead
Center for International Affairs supports a central mission
of Harvard University—research—both directly and
indirectly. It supports large-scale collaborative research
endeavors through its Weatherhead Initiative grants as well
as individual faculty research semesters and other means.
It also constructs venues for the exchange of ideas, the refinement
of concepts, and the diffusion of knowledge. That is why a

Study Abroad
There is no real substitute for time spent in another country. For
more than three decades the Weatherhead Center has celebrated the
importance of international education by providing summer travel
grants to undergraduates who plan to conduct senior thesis research
